    Factors to Consider When Choosing Best Ceramic Tools Bundle For Home Studio

    Choosing the best ceramic tools bundle for your home studio requires attention to several critical factors. Beyond just the number of tools, consider the quality of materials, comfort of use, and whether the set includes accessories like storage cases or aprons. Compatibility with your skill level and the types of projects you plan to undertake can also influence your decision. Being aware of common pitfalls—such as buying too many low-quality tools or sets that lack essential items—helps you make smarter choices. Here are the main considerations to keep in mind:

    Tool Quality and Material

    High-quality tools made from durable materials like stainless steel or hardwood ensure longevity and better handling. Cheaper sets often use lower-grade plastics or flimsy components that break easily or feel uncomfortable during extended use. Investing in quality tools can save money over time, especially if you plan to work regularly or on larger projects.

    Variety and Completeness

    A comprehensive set should include a mix of shaping, carving, trimming, and detailing tools. Avoid bundles that only focus on one aspect of ceramics unless that aligns with your specific needs. Sets with a variety of sizes and shapes give you more creative flexibility and help prevent the need to purchase additional tools later.

    Ease of Use and Comfort

    Look for ergonomic designs, especially if you’ll be working for long periods. Wooden handles or textured grips provide better control and reduce hand fatigue. Beginners should prioritize user-friendly tools that are straightforward to handle without sacrificing precision.

    Price and Value

    While price is an important factor, it’s often better to pay a little more for tools that will last and perform well. Cheaper sets may seem attractive initially but can lead to frustration or additional purchases down the line. Consider the overall value, including the quality of tools, included accessories, and brand reputation.

    Additional Accessories

    Storage cases, aprons, and cleaning tools add convenience and help keep your workspace organized. These extras can be especially valuable in a home studio setting, where space and organization are key. Think about whether these accessories are included or need to be purchased separately when comparing options.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Is it better to buy a large set with many tools or a smaller, specialized kit?

    The choice depends on your experience level and project scope. Larger sets provide versatility and are great for beginners wanting to explore different techniques. However, they may include tools you won’t use often, potentially cluttering your workspace. Smaller, specialized kits are ideal if you focus on specific tasks like sculpting or trimming, offering better quality tools for those particular functions. Balancing your immediate needs with future growth will help in selecting the right size for your home studio.

    Are ceramic tools suitable for all types of clay and ceramics?

    While most ceramic tools are designed to work with a variety of clays, certain tools may perform better with specific materials like polymer clay, air-dry clay, or traditional pottery clay. For example, softer tools may be better for delicate work, while more robust tools handle thicker, denser clays. It’s important to choose a set compatible with your preferred medium to ensure ease of use and durability.

    Should I prioritize a set with a carrying case or storage options?

    Yes, especially if you plan to move your tools frequently or want to keep your workspace organized. A dedicated case or bag helps protect your tools from damage and makes storage more efficient. For home studios with limited space, these accessories also make it easier to locate and access the tools you need without clutter. However, don’t sacrifice tool quality for storage; both are important for a satisfying experience.

    What is the best material for ceramic tools’ handles?

    Wooden handles are popular for their comfort and classic feel, offering good grip and control. Some high-end sets use rubberized or textured grips for enhanced ergonomics, especially during longer sessions. Avoid tools with slippery or cheaply made handles, as they can cause fatigue or reduce precision. The right handle material can significantly improve your comfort and accuracy during sculpting and trimming tasks.

    Can I buy individual tools instead of a bundle, and is that better?

    Buying individual tools allows for customization based on your specific needs, which can be advantageous if you already know what you require. However, it’s often more cost-effective to purchase a well-rounded bundle that offers a variety of essential tools. For beginners, a complete set simplifies the process of building a functional toolkit, ensuring you don’t miss critical items. More experienced users might prefer to expand their collection gradually with specialized tools.
